Infoton was a manufacturer of video display terminals.

Infoton
Second Avenue
Burlington, MA 01803
(617) 272-6660[1]

News Items

  • September 27, 1972: Infoton terminals used to register attendees at Wescon
  • October 23, 1974: Optical Scanning Corp. takes over marketing and servicing of Infoton terminals for end-users, while Infoton continues to service OEM markets.[2]
  • March 1, 1976: Ted Robinson appointed vice-president of the Infoton division of Optical Scanning Corp.[3]
